The Cultural Significance of Classic Fruit Symbols in Seasonal Decor

Historically, many cultures have imbued certain fruits with symbolic meanings linked to seasonal festivities. For instance:

  • Pomegranates: Symbolising fertility and rebirth, often featured in the winter solstice and New Year celebrations in Mediterranean and Middle Eastern traditions.
  • Apples: Associated with health, knowledge, and temptation, frequently incorporated into autumnal harvest festivals.
  • Fig Fruits: Represents abundance and fertility in various ancient societies, used in seasonal feasts and rituals.

Decorative representations of these fruits, especially in painted, embroidered, or sculpted forms, serve as both aesthetic embellishments and carriers of deeper cultural narratives. The challenge for contemporary designers and decorators is to preserve this symbolism while adding a fresh, engaging twist that resonates with today’s aesthetics.
